Current stories revealed that Binance Govt Tigran Gambaryan’s bail listening to has been postponed to Might 17, 2024. On Tuesday, the Federal Excessive Courtroom, Abuja, mounted the date for the listening to, following the defendant’s request to go away the infamous Kuje jail.
Gambaryan’s lawyer, Mark Mordi, requested Justice Emeka Nwite to situation the defendant’s bail arguing that the Nigerian authority has failed to supply credible proof for his or her claims. He acknowledged,
“There isn’t any exhibit or doc displaying EFCC’s credible intelligence…There isn’t any approach any cheap courtroom can come to a conclusion on proof reminiscent of this.”
Nonetheless, Financial Monetary Crimes Fee (EFCC) counsel E. Iheanacho argued that the Binance government’s bail could be a grave threat because the defendant has no acquaintance in Nigeria. Iheanacho claimed that Gambryan tried to use for a brand new US passport, though he knew his passport had been seized.
Beforehand, Binance executives- Tigran Gambaryan and Nadeem Anjarwalla- had been arrested and detained by the Nigerian authority as a part of the allegations towards Binance Nigeria, together with $26 billion in unlawful inflows.
Subsequently, the executives sued the Nigerian authorities for allegedly violating their basic rights. Gambaryan’s lawyer, Olujoke Aliyu, requested the courtroom to launch him from authorized custody and retrieve his passport. Gambaryan filed lawsuits towards Nigeria’s Nationwide Safety Adviser (NSA) and EFCC.
The executives’ attorneys highlighted their innocence, stating that they had been arrested once they reached Nigeria at an invite from the Nigerian authority. They acknowledged, “The one purpose for his detention is as a result of the federal government is requesting info from Binance and making calls for on the corporate.”
